How to buy an Inexpensive Car

Jan 17th, 2010

If you want to buy a new car than the first thing you have to decide is what is your budget. The definition of inexpensive cars is different among people. Some will look for a cheap car averaging $20k while others are looking for a $1000 inexpensive car. This article will lay out how you can buy an inexpensive car as low as $1000 but the same tips are usable for every car you want to buy.

Be realistic

We are trying to get ourselves a cheap car and we already gave our self a budget that defined cheap. Probably the most important thing to realize is that we will not get your dream car for so little money. But the up side is that you can get a great car for $1000 but you have to deal with certain facts before you do.

* The cars you will look for are probably between 10-15 years old. If you are buying your car in rust areas than age is a very important thing. If you life in a sunbelt area than older cars are more likely to be a good bet because they have experienced less smog and are therefore easier to repair.

* You have to take the integrity above the looks of the car. Most cars will have bad paint or they might have dents on it but the integrity is far more important.

* You want to look for less popular models. This is very important to keep in mind, you will be able to get better less desired models in appropriate state compared to very desired models. The only way you will get a desired model for $1000 is when it is trashed.

Where to look for an Inexpensive Car?

So we know we will not get a luxurious car for the money we have to spend, but where do we have to look in order to find inexpensive cars?

* The first place you should look at is in your own neighborhood. When people want to sell their car they will often put signs on it with their phone number. Try to find an older cheap car and see if you can get it for the money you want to spend. You can find these cars in driveways or in front or repair shops. Sometimes people don't feel like to pay for the repairs anymore and they leave their car in front of the shop. In order to buy these cars you often have to pay for the repairs.

* Let your friends know that you are looking for a car. Sometimes a sociable network is the best way to find yourself a cheap car.

* Look for advertisements in your local newspaper.

* Auctions are a great place to get yourself a cheap car but there are some things to consider before doing this. If you want a really inexpensive car than this is the way to do it but you will not get a test drive and you are not allowed to inspect the car. There is always a chance that you will buy a piece of metal trash

* New And Used Car Dealers: In most cases this is not a good place to look for new cars as you will get nothing for $1000. But sometimes they will have cars they want to send to an auction and maybe they want to sell it to you instead. This will save them a few hundred bucks and you will have a cheap car.

How to pick a Winner

You can never be sure that you will buy a winner for $1000, there is always a chance that you will make a bad deal. But you can lesson the chance on making a bad deal in the followings ways.

* If you do not have a lot of knowledge about cars, be sure to take someone with you that does.

* Check if the most important car accessories work. Check the heating, lights, windows if they work. You should ignore minor electrical faults, most important is that you car works and that it is safe.

* Check the Fluids

* Check the Tires

* Take the car for a test drive. There is no better way to see if you like the car by making a test drive with the car. You want to make sure you don't hear any weird noises and that the accelerating system and brakes are working properly.

* Check if their are any records about the car

Buy your Inexpensive Car

Before you buy your car there are still a few things to do in order to be sure that you are making a good deal. Let a mechanic inspect the car and see if the car will need any major repairs soon. Off course there will be flaws on your car but you don't want them to be too expensive. The inspection will cost you on average $75 but it is worth it. It will help you from making a big mistake that will cost you $1000.

You also have to check all the paperwork. Make sure that there are not many back fees to it because you have to register it. best case scenario is that your car is registered and that the owner has a pink slip. Consider checking with the DMV if you have any doubts. If everything is ok than you just bought an inexpensive car for $1000.
